HIV Testing (4th Generation & RNA)

Advanced HIV Testing in Laporte, PA

We offer 4th generation antigen/antibody testing and FDA-approved HIV RNA early detection for the earliest reliable diagnosis (as soon as 10-12 days post-exposure). Confidential lab-based results with counseling.

Herpes Testing (HSV-1 & HSV-2)

Herpes Testing Near Laporte

Type-specific IgG blood testing distinguishes HSV-1 (oral) from HSV-2 (genital). Important for asymptomatic screening; accurate laboratory interpretation and local access at Laporte testing site.

Why Regular STD Testing Matters for Laporte Residents

Regular STD testing is a key part of sexual health for people in Laporte and surrounding Sullivan County. Many STIs are asymptomatic, which means infections like chlamydia, gonorrhea, and early HIV can go unnoticed without screening. The CDC recommends routine screening for sexually active individuals, annual testing for those with new or multiple partners, and more frequent testing for higher-risk behaviors. Nationally, about 1 in 5 Americans has an STI at any given time; local rural communities see cases too, often identified during routine screening or after exposure. Early detection enables simple, effective treatment for most bacterial infections and timely medical care for viral infections. Regular STI screening reduces transmission, protects fertility and long-term health, and provides peace of mind. In Laporte, testing is accessible and confidential—make testing part of regular care, especially after new partners or symptoms, and use local sexual health resources for follow-up and counseling.
